#!/bin/bash
# Script to clean up all AWS resources created by the LAMP stack deployment
# Set environment variables
export ENVIRONMENT=aws
export AWS_REGION=${AWS_REGION:-us-east-1}
# Check if AWS credentials are configured
if [ -z "$AWS_ACCESS_KEY_ID" ] || [ -z "$AWS_SECRET_ACCESS_KEY" ]; then
echo "AWS credentials not found. Please configure your AWS credentials."
echo "You can set them as environment variables or configure the AWS CLI with 'aws configure'."
exit 1
fi
# Create a directory for logs
mkdir -p logs
# Prompt for confirmation
echo "WARNING: This script will delete all AWS resources created by the LAMP stack deployment."
echo "This action cannot be undone."
read -p "Are you sure you want to continue? (y/n) " -n 1 -r
echo
if [[ ! $REPLY =~ ^[Yy]$ ]]; then
echo "Cleanup cancelled."
exit 0
fi
# Run the cleanup playbook
echo "Cleaning up AWS resources..."
ansible-playbook playbooks/cleanup.yml -v | tee logs/aws_cleanup.log
# Check the result
if [ ${PIPESTATUS[0]} -eq 0 ]; then
echo "Cleanup completed successfully!"
echo "All AWS resources have been deleted."
else
echo "Cleanup failed or completed with warnings. Check logs/aws_cleanup.log for details."
echo "Some resources may still exist in your AWS account."
fi
